NY Next Generation Math NY-2.OA.2.a
The Standard
Fluently add and subtract within 20 using mental strategies. Strategies could include: counting on, making ten, decomposing a number leading to a ten, using the relationship between addition and subtraction, and creating equivalent but easier or known sums.

What This Standard Means
What Students Need to Do
- Students add and subtract within 20 accurately, efficiently, and flexibly using mental strategies. They may count on, make ten, decompose to ten, use related facts, or create an easier equivalent sum.
What Mastery Looks Like
- The student solves 8 + 6 by making 10 and solves 13 - 4 by stepping through 10. The student chooses a useful strategy without needing every fact memorized.
Common Misconceptions
- Students may think fluency means answering instantly or using only memorized facts. They may apply a strategy mechanically without preserving the value of the expression.
How to Assess It
- Give six mixed facts within 20, including 8 + 7 and 14 - 6. Ask students to solve mentally and explain two strategies.
Lesson moves
Ways to Teach It
Use ten-frames and counters to practice making ten, decomposing through ten, and connecting related facts.
Ask students which mental strategy fits 9 + 6 best and why.
Play strategy switch, solving fact cards with two different mental methods before keeping the card.
Mentally update small attendance or supply totals as amounts are added and removed within 20.
